Pearson 26ft

  • Beam: 8
  • Draft: 4
  • Description: 1974 Pearson 26 ft Pearson sailboat with 2009 9.9 electric start power stroke, Yamaha outboard engine with 2 batteries. Price reduced from 6500.00. Must sell found a new boat. Mainsail in good condition, new batteries, Hood Jib 150 furler. Engine serviced and winterized every season. Very low hours. with 8 ft tender, life preservers. Needs yearly bottom paint. ready to go with two 6 gallon gas tanks.
  • Equipment: 9.9 motor, custom tiller, life preservers, 2 batteries,2 gas tanks 6 gallons each, sails
